Slashing away at a block with heavy earthmoving machinery might seem straightforward, but unqualified land clearing regularly ends in disaster. A contractor with a bobcat and no arboricultural training can easily rip through the Structural Root Zones (SRZ) of the exact trees you want to keep. This mechanical damage drastically destabilises mature established trees like Milky Pine or native Hoop Pine, turning them into severe hazards during the next tropical storm.
Furthermore, haphazard DIY clearing often breaches Cairns Regional Council regulations. Clearing assessable vegetation without a Development Permit for Operational Works can lead to devastating fines. You also run the risk of uncontrolled erosion on steeper hillside blocks, watching your topsoil wash away with the first heavy monsoon downpour.
Our team brings a completely different, highly regulated approach. We don't just flatten the block; we assess the site properly. When selective clearing is required, we identify and protect significant trees in strict accordance with AS4970 (Protection of Trees on Development Sites). We establish clear Tree Protection Zones (TPZ) so our machinery operations won't compact the soil around retained timber. The result is a clean, level, and usable site, with your remaining trees healthy, stable, and compliant with all local planning schemes.
We utilise commercial-grade equipment and proven arboricultural methods to process vegetation efficiently, regardless of the site's density, slope, or coastal terrain.
We completely clear footprints for new homes, sheds, and extensions. This involves the systematic removal of understory, scrub, and target trees, leaving a clean, hazard-free slate for builders and earthworkers.
We carefully remove dense undergrowth, declared weeds, and invasive saplings while preserving significant native canopy trees. All retained trees are protected under strict AS4970 arboricultural standards.
For properties mapped under Cairns bushfire overlays, we clear specific vegetation to establish compliant firebreaks and defendable spaces, ensuring you meet AS3959 construction requirements for bushfire-prone areas.
We utilize high-capacity 12-inch wood chippers to process cleared vegetation. You can choose to retain this coarse mulch for on-site erosion control, or have us haul it entirely away in our tipper trucks.
Surface clearing isn't always enough for development. We deploy self-propelled stump grinders to mill stumps and surface roots down to 150-300mm below grade, ensuring the ground is entirely clear for foundations.

Working in Trinity Beach means dealing with a diverse coastal landscape, from the sandy, salt-exposed flats full of Alexandra Palms to the steeper, rainforest-clad foothills backing onto Smithfield. Cairns Regional Council manages the largest urban canopy in the country, and their CairnsPlan 2016 strictly defines vegetation damage. Assessable clearing on private land typically requires a Development Permit for Operational Works (Vegetation Clearing).
However, our local hazard calendar often dictates our work. Following Severe Tropical Cyclone Narelle in March 2026, a state disaster clearing exemption is currently active until 18 March 2027 for the Cairns Disaster District. This allows landholders to clear vegetation necessary to prevent property damage or to safely remove fallen woody debris without standard state approvals.
We understand exactly how to operate within these exemptions while maintaining the required photographic evidence. Whether you are dealing with aggressive regrowth of African Tulip and Cadaghi trees, or prepping a site before the next monsoon hits, our local knowledge ensures your clearing is both completely legal and perfectly timed.
Once we have finished your land clearing, protecting the exposed soil is your priority, especially heading into the tropical wet season. We highly recommend spreading the fresh, coarse mulch we produce evenly across the site to suppress aggressive weed regrowth and prevent topsoil erosion during heavy monsoon rains. If you plan to build, keep foot and vehicle traffic strictly out of the Tree Protection Zones (TPZ) of any retained timber to avoid soil compaction. In the tropics, saplings and pioneer vines shoot up fast; give us a call if you need a follow-up weed and regrowth control sweep in six to twelve months to keep your block pristine.
